1.0 out of 5 stars Pass, August 21, 2003
By A Customer
This review is from: Entertainment Weekly: Greatest Hits 1988 (Audio CD)
One of the weaker sets in this series isn't a total loss thanks to a slew of guilty pleasures in Eric Carmen's "Make Me Lose Control," Terence Trent D'arby's Prince knockoff "Wishing Well," INXS' "Need You Tonight," and Boy Meets Girl cheesy pop gem "Waiting for a Star to Fall." Sadly, this is all offset by some really dreadful junk by Taylor Dane, Rick Astley, Billy Ocean, Expose, and the highly offensive "Don't Worry, Be Happy," by the normally talented Bobby McFerrin. Missing from this set: Tracy Chapman's "Fast Car," Edie Brickell's "What I Am," Midnight Oil's "Beds Are Burning," R.E.M's "Stand," and Pet Shop Boys' "What Have I Done to Deserve This."
